Google’s quantum computing program is approaching a crucial stage, with expectations of significant breakthroughs within the next five years. Sundar Pichai, CEO of Google, has highlighted quantum computing as a potential major technological advancement, following the rise of artificial intelligence.
“Quantum computing promises to be the next frontier in computing capabilities,” Pichai noted, emphasizing its potential impact on solving complex problems beyond the reach of today’s computers.
Quantum computing could revolutionize fields such as cryptography, materials science, and complex system modeling, according to Google’s roadmap. This new technology aims to transcend traditional computing limits, leading to advances in medicine, energy, and more.
Pichai suggested that just as AI has reshaped various industries, quantum computing could similarly transform technology landscapes, enabling breakthroughs currently unimaginable with classical computing.
While progress is promising, challenges remain before quantum computing becomes mainstream. Over the next half-decade, Google plans to demonstrate clear quantum advantages and expand the technology’s practical applications.
Pichai acknowledged the complexity involved but remains optimistic about achieving scalable, reliable quantum computers that could eventually operate beyond experimental labs.
